Thoughts on the perforation:
It is documented that when the bag was first designed, the purpose of the perforations was to enable air circulation around the grooming kit and would not be facing outwards.
This design decision is reinforced by the way in which the fastening, which traditionally would be on the outside of bags (e.g. Kelly, Birkin, Constance, Roulis . . .), is on the non perforated side.
It really does not matter which way people choose to wear their Evelynes.
It is not a right or wrong with serious consequences like putting diesel in you petrol car.
What I think is interesting is that when the sellier version was developed, the subtly stylised H was impressed onto the side with the fastening. i.e. the front of the bag
Is this a recognition that the preferred way of carrying the original Evelyne is with the perforated logo outward facing?
